1. Xi Jinping arrives in Vietnam to boost political, trade ties amid US tariffs

Chinese President Xi Jinping landed in the Vietnamese capital of Hanoi on Monday in his first overseas trip of the year as part of an effort to cement stronger strategic ties in Southeast Asia amid an escalating trade war with the US.

2. Ex-diplomat Kerry Brown on how Trump ‘stunned’ China with his ‘lack of caution’

King’s College, London professor says he “cannot think of a worse tactic” than threatening Beijing and presenting “zero-sum” options.

3. China to restrict Tibet access for US officials in visa tit-for-tat

Non-Chinese visitors to Tibet must obtain special permits, which are typically granted to tourists who book with approved travel operators. Photo: Xinhua

China has announced visa restrictions on “US personnel who have acted egregiously” on Tibet issues, two weeks after Washington imposed visa limits on Chinese officials involved in policies restricting foreigners’ access to the region.
